    Dand522612Dand522612 Posts: 417 ✭✭✭

    Has to be a reholder. Cards with certs starting with zero have been originally graded a while ago. Someone has more detail on the timing. And yes the card in my experience will always keep the same number. What a beautiful card, better question why no 8.5 with that centering? Maybe just reholdered and not reviewed.

  • Options
    Dand522612Dand522612 Posts: 417 ✭✭✭

    Edit: if the card bumps then the cert number will change.

    I checked the site as well. Notice the 2 vertical marks on Mickeys bridge of his nose. The registration of the outer part of the name box shows a fair amount of white. The logo box has a broken black line across the top. On the reverse of the card there is a slight circular stain to the right of MANTLE name. I agree I did see the "mole" mark (tan in color) to the left of the logo.
